Job Description

We are building Kafka Connect charter which is core for scalable and reliable streaming data between Apache Kafka® and other data systems. It makes it simple to quickly define connectors that move large data sets in and out of Kafka. Kafka Connect can ingest entire databases or collect metrics from all your application servers into Kafka topics, making the data available for stream processing with low latency. An export connector can deliver data from Kafka topics into secondary indexes like Elasticsearch, or into batch systems–such as Hadoop for offline analysis.
